The aim was to develop a methodology for assessing the effectiveness of the national implementation of multilateral environmental agreements (MEAs) in the clusters of biodiversity and chemicals/waste.
For that the existing review mechanisms for MEAs were analyzed and assessed against those existing under different regimes, such as the WHO, WTO, etc. Criteria for assessing the effectiveness of MEAs and their implementation in context of the three pillars of sustainable development: environment, economy and society were proposed.
